Choosing the Right Pergola Structure for Privacy
The type of pergola structure you choose plays a crucial role in achieving the desired level of privacy. Open-roof pergolas offer a connection to the sky but provide minimal privacy. For enhanced seclusion, consider a pergola with a closed roof, retractable canopy, or adjustable louvers. This allows you to control the amount of sunlight and visibility, creating a more intimate atmosphere. Another important factor is the placement of the pergola. Positioning it strategically near trees or existing structures can further enhance privacy.
Enhancing Pergola Privacy with Screens and Walls
Adding screens or walls to your pergola is an effective way to block unwanted views and create a secluded space. Lattice panels offer a decorative touch while allowing filtered light and airflow. For more complete privacy, consider using solid panels, bamboo screens, or outdoor curtains. These options provide a solid barrier against prying eyes while still maintaining a sense of enclosure. Incorporating Greenery for Natural Privacy
Plants are a beautiful and natural way to enhance pergola privacy. Climbing vines, such as ivy, wisteria, or bougainvillea, can be trained to grow up and over the pergola structure, creating a living screen. Potted plants and strategically placed shrubs around the perimeter of the pergola can also add to the sense of seclusion. Lighting and Decor for a Private Pergola Retreat
The right lighting and decor can further enhance the privacy and ambiance of your pergola. String lights, lanterns, or strategically placed spotlights can create a warm and inviting atmosphere while adding to the sense of enclosure. Comfortable outdoor furniture, cushions, and rugs can complete the look and make your pergola a true extension of your living space.

Maintenance and Care for Your Privacy Pergola
Maintaining your pergola is essential for preserving its privacy features and ensuring its longevity. Regular cleaning, staining, or sealing will protect the structure from the elements and keep it looking its best. If you’ve incorporated plants into your design, proper pruning and care will ensure they continue to thrive and provide the desired level of privacy. “Regular maintenance is key to preserving the beauty and functionality of your pergola,” advises landscape architect, Amelia Carter, in her book “Outdoor Living Spaces.” This includes cleaning debris, checking for structural integrity, and treating the wood or metal to prevent weathering and rot.
